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ar) at a glance

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ar)

Knipescar Common at 341m (1,119ft) is an Outlying Fell on the limestone escarpment above the Lowther valley near Shap, giving views across the Haweswater fells and over the pastoral Lowther valley. Wainwright included it in his Outlying Fells guide as part of the Around Penrith group. The limestone pavement and scar give the fell its distinctive character.

The short answers

Is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ar) a Wainwright?

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ar) is one of Wainwright's Outlying Fells, not one of the 214 in the Pictorial Guides. It is also on the Birkett list and the Synge list.

Where do you park for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ar)?

The nearest car park we hold is Knipescar Common (verge), about 0.7 km from the summit in a straight line. The next is Knipescar Common, south-west (layby), 1.5 km out. We only look within 2.5 km, measured straight-line: over longer distances a road may cross a pass and the drive bears no relation to the line.

How hard is Knipescar Common (Knipe Scar)?

The shortest way up we hold is Knipe Scar - Birkett — 5.7 km, 166 m of ascent, about 1.4 hours. On our scale its hardest axis is navigation — Hard.

All axes: navigation: Hard · terrain: Moderate · steepness: Moderate · exposure: Easy · length: Easy.
